Pacific West Homes Proposes 141 Unit Trilogy Condominimum Project in Middle of Single Family Home Neighborhood
The common thread heard all evening from the surrounding home owners was that no one has any objection to high density housing - in the proper location. This is NOT the proper location. It just does NOT fit. It did NOT fit when it was 154 units called Mirabella and it still does NOT fit with 13 fewer units called Trilogy.

On thing to keep in mind, with the Architectural Review Commission, is that they ONLY are able to take comments regarding architectural issues - and can not discuss zoning issues, or even if condos vs. retail/commercial is the right thing to do. Therefore, we need to direct the discussion towards what we WOULD agree to having in our neighborhood - IF the Planning Commission and City Council would ultimately rule in favor of rezoning from Retail - Light Commercial (current zoning) to Multi-Family.
The general opinion seems to be that perhaps retail may not be economically viable for the entire 10 or 11 acres. However, ideas were presented at our last community park meeting regarding mixed use, with possible some retail right on the corner and perhaps single story luxury condos on the rest of the property.
Most people so far that I have talked with seem to be comfortable with the idea of maybe 40 to 50 single story luxury condos on this property, if we can't have our originally planned neighborhood retail center or single family detached homes. This is something where we CAN make our voices heard with the Architectural Review Commission. In fact, we should press them hard to ONLY APPROVE 40 to 50 single story luxury condos, with steep pitched roofs, multi-faceted roof lines with dormers, stone facades, and other architectural design features that would make a project of this nature FIT in our current community. Any project with more than 50 units just would be too dense to blend in with our current single family residential communities of Empire Ranch and The Parkway.
